Abstract The changes introduced in February 2019 to the Basic Law, Ukraine formally declared the strategic course of the state to gain full membership in the European Union and the North Atlantic Treaty Organization. In the Preamble to the Constitution, the Verkhovna Rada of Ukraine, on behalf of the Ukrainian people, confirmed its European identity, and also stated the irreversibility of the European and Euro-Atlantic course. Therefore, today, as never before, it is important and urgent to take into account the best world practices on various aspects of the functioning of the state, and above all, it is relevant to the military sphere.
The Republic of Italy is a developed democratic state, with a powerful military potential and centuries-long experience of the functioning of the army. A reform of military service and military careers has taken place in Italy, in 2017, and it made it possible to unify and optimize the relevant procedures.
The purpose of the article is a comparative legal study of some issues of military service under the legislation of Ukraine and the Republic of Italy.
The article analyzes some indicators characterizing the military power of these states. Constitutional provisions in the field of defense and protection of these countries are presented. The structure of the Armed Forces of Italy and Ukraine is explored. So, it is noted that the Armed Forces of Italy include: the army, navy, air force, carabinieri corps while the fiscal guard belongs to the Ministry of Treasure. The latter two structures have military personnel, but their functions are of a police nature.
Particular attention is paid to the issues of military justice. It is established that in Italy there are both military prosecutors and military courts in accordance with three military districts; there is also a military supervisory authority with penitentiary functions.
The provisions on compulsory recruitment of military service in these countries are compared. The main aspects of the reform of the role and careers of the personnel of the Armed Forces in the Republic of Italy in 2017 are mentioned.
Finally, issues of gender equality and equal opportunities for female servicemen’ careers were explored.
As a conclusion, based on the analysis of the Military Organization of Italy and Ukraine, it was stated that the problem of the formation of military justice bodies in Ukraine needs to be seriously addressed by the legislator. This system should take into account the principle of separation of powers in Ukraine (legislative, executive, judicial branches) and include military courts, the military prosecutor’s office and the military investigation authority (as the central executive body), which must be staffed with military personnel, taking into account the principle of gender equality. Therefore, the experience of the military system of the law enforcement agencies of the Italian Republic must be thoroughly studied and taken into account as much as possible. It is also worth taking into account the positive experience of the Republic of Italy in matters of harmonized terms of service in the military rank for servicemen.
